Preguntas y Respuestas sobre programación en Office

Id. de artículo: 550244 - Ver los productos a los que se aplica este artículo
Este artículo se publicó anteriormente con el número E10245
Expandir todo | Contraer todo

Resumen

En este artículo encontrará las preguntas y respuestas más usuales sobre programación en Office 97.

Más información

  1. ¿Cuáles son las cinco principales mejoras en Office 97 para el desarrollador?

    Respuesta: Las principales ventajas son:
    1. Visual Basic para Aplicaciones 5.0, Entorno de desarrollo integrado mejorado (IDE), Microsoft Forms, tecnología Intellisense, examinador de objetos mejorado, rendimiento mejorado. Visual Basic para Aplicaciones esta incluido con Microsoft Word , el programa de presentaciones gráficas PowerPoint, Microsoft Excel, y Microsoft Access.
    2. Modelo de objetos mejorado, Todas las aplicaciones Office tiene ahora un modelo de objetos más amplio y lógico con una consistencia ampliamente mejorada.
    3. Soporte para controles ActiveX, Se soportan en Microsoft Forms y en los documentos de Office.
    4. Nueva funcionalidad de Office, Microsoft Outlook, Office Assistant, OfficeArt, Barras de comandos, Hiperlinks y otras características nuevas que tengan modelos de objetos programable.
    5. ODBCDirect, Más velocidad, menor consumo de recursos en el acceso al servidor de los dotas. Es parte del modelo de objetos (DAO), así que los desarrolladores no tendrán que aprenderse un nuevo modelo de objetos.
  2. ¿Soportan todas las aplicaciones de Office 97 Visual Basic para Aplicaciones?

    Respuesta: Sí, todas las aplicaciones de Office soportan Visual Basic para Aplicaciones. Microsoft Word , Microsoft Excel, Microsoft PowerPoint, Microsoft Access tienen el entorno de desarrollo Visual Basic para Aplicaciones y pueden manejar todas las aplicaciones Office, incluyendo Microsoft Outlook.
  3. ¿Se puede desarrollar soluciones con Microsoft Outlook?

    Respuesta: Los desarrolladores tienen varias opciones para utilizar Microsoft Outlook soluciones personalizadas. Pueden utilizar Visual Basic para aplicaciones en otras aplicaciones Office para controlar Outlook, o pueden utilizar Visual Basic y Microsoft Forms dentro de Outlook.
  4. ¿Qué son Microsoft Forms?

    Respuesta: Microsoft Forms es un paquete de formularios incluido en el entorno de desarrollo de Microsoft Visual Basic para Aplicaciones. Microsoft Forms posibilita a los desarrolladores la creación de interfaces de usuario personalizados que incluyan controles ActiveX y para responder a las peticiones del usuario mediante código con Visual Basic para aplicaciones.
  5. ¿Puedo compartir Microsoft Forms entre Office y VBScript en el cuadro de controles ActiveX?

    Respuesta: Sí. Si ha creado un formulario utilizando Microsoft Forms en Office, el formulario (y los controles ActiveX del formulario) pueden ser utilizados con Visual Basic, Edición Scripting(VbScript) en el cuadro de controles ActiveX. VBScript es un subconjunto de Visual Basic para Aplicaciones 5.0, por esto algunas aplicaciones hechas en Visual Basic para Aplicaciones pueden tener que ser modificadas para ejecutarse en un entorno VBScript.
  6. ¿Soporta Microsoft Access Microsoft Forms?

    Respuesta: Microsoft Access 97 continua soportando los formularios de Microsoft Access. Microsoft Forms no se incluye en esta nueva versión de Microsoft Access para mantener compatibilidad con versiones anteriores. La estrategia de Microsoft es incluir un paquete de formularios compartidos por todas las versiones futuras de sus productos.
  7. ¿Existe una grabadora de macros en Microsoft Word 97 y Microsoft PowerPoint 97?

    Respuesta: Sí. Además de en Microsoft Excel, Word Y PowerPoint ahora soportan la grabación de macros. Las macros son grabadas en Visual Basic para Aplicaciones y se pueden editar en el entorno de programación de Visual Basic para Aplicaciones.
  8. ¿Sabiendo que Microsoft Office posibilidad a los usuarios deshabilitar las macros, como puedo asegurar que los usuarios no modificaran los documentos sin ejecutar mi código.?

    Respuesta: Puede asegurar que sus documentos no serán modificados usando una protección mediante contraseña sobre los documentos y permitiendo el acceso solo mediante código. De esta manera, incluso si los usuarios abren sus documentos sin código, no serán capaces de hacer ningún cambio a no ser que habiliten la ejecución del código.
  9. ¿Qué pasos se seguirán para manejar los virus en Office 97?

    Respuesta: Las aplicaciones de Microsoft Office 97 detectaran que un usuario intenta abrir un archivo que incluye macros. La aplicación avisará al usuario que el documento incluye macros y ofrecerá la posibilidad de deshabilitarlas. El usuario podrá elegir entre abrir el documento con las macros activadas o con las macros desactivadas. El usuario también podrá deshabilitar los mensajes de alerta para futuras ocasiones en las que se abra el documento. Microsoft Office incluye una opción en el menú Herramientas-Opciones para volver a habilitar estos mensajes de alerta. Microsoft Access no sigue este modelo.
  10. ¿Pueden los desarrolladores evitar que los usuarios finales vean el código fuente de aplicaciones hechas en Visual Basic Para Aplicaciones en Office 97?

    Respuesta: Sí. El entorno de programación de Visual Basic Para Aplicaciones en Office 97 soporta dos niveles de protección con contraseña. Los desarrolladores pueden proteger contra escritura un documento entero o solo la parte de código del documento. El código de Visual Basic que sea protegido con contraseña estará encriptado y no podrá ser visto sin la contraseña.

Propiedades

Id. de artículo: 550244 - Última revisión: sábado, 19 de abril de 1997 - Versión: 1.0
La información de este artículo se refiere a:
  • Microsoft Office 97 Standard Edition
Palabras clave: 
kbfaq office97 p&r pregunta programación respuesta KB550244
Renuncia a responsabilidad de los contenidos de la KB sobre productos a los que ya no se ofrece asistencia alguna
El presente artículo se escribió para productos para los que Microsoft ya no ofrece soporte técnico. Por tanto, el presente artículo se ofrece "tal cual" y no será actualizado.

Enviar comentarios

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com